A Water Pumping Photovoltaic Powered System Based on a Merged DC-DC Sepic-Cuk Converter

Ver documento

Detalhes bibliográficos
Resumo:This paper has the purpose to present a non-isolated dual output DC-DC converter for a water pumping photovoltaic powered system. The proposed topology is based in the integration of a traditional Sepic and Cuk converters but requires only a single power semiconductor switch. It is characterized by an extension of the voltage static gain when compared with the classical boost topology and by a reduced voltage stress across the power switch and diodes. The system will be implemented through a classical MPPT algorithm that will control the proposed DC-DC converter. Several simulation and experimental results are also presented in order to confirm the characteristics of the proposed power converter and global water pumping systems.
